The handle of a Prada Re-Edition bag has a woven tape that runs across the back of the bag that is symmetrically stitched. The zipper head has a matte finish and a horseshoe-shaped loop. This guarantees that the bag is of a uniform size. Furthermore, authentic Prada Re-Edition 2000 will have the brand's name engraved on the hardware of the bag, such as buckles, zippers and metal feet. Genuine Prada bags only use zippers made by reliable brands like Riri, Opti, Riri, YKK and Lampo. Authentic Prada bags are only equipped with these zippers that are branded, so if there are any other brands on the zipper, it's most likely a counterfeit. The Re-Edition 2006 In 1913, the brothers Mario and Martino, Fratelli Prada was Italy's first luxury leather goods store. Though the business suffered a dip after the death of the patriarch's son in 1952 it was revived in 1975 when Miuccia Prada joined the family company as a designer of accessories. In the early aughts her nylon creations were the sought-after “It Bags” of the day. The light, durable designs provided a refreshing alternative to other brands' heavier leather designs, and quickly gained recognition. A quick tip: The easiest way to spot a fake Prada 2005 Re-Edition nylon bag is to look at the inside of the pocket. The label's text of a fake bag will be spelled incorrectly or have an unreadable font size compared to the original bag. Pay attention to glue spots and white spots at the junction of the bottom and the material on the other side. These are signs that the bag was not properly constructed. This collection utilizes a unique fabric called ECONYL, which is a new type of recycled nylon made from waste from a variety of sources, including fishing nets and other waste materials from the ocean. The new nylon repels water better than regular nylon, and the reworked version is designed to stand up to heavy usage.
